KronisLV|6 months ago
If you look at the folders there, you'll see that all of the older Dockerfiles have been removed, even for versions of software that are not EOL.
For example:
PostgreSQL 13 (gone): https://github.com/bitnami/containers/tree/main/bitnami/post...
PostgreSQL 14 (gone): https://github.com/bitnami/containers/tree/main/bitnami/post...
PostgreSQL 15 (gone): https://github.com/bitnami/containers/tree/main/bitnami/post...
PostgreSQL 16 (gone): https://github.com/bitnami/containers/tree/main/bitnami/post...
PostgreSQL 17 (present): https://github.com/bitnami/containers/tree/main/bitnami/post...
> The source code for containers and Helm charts remains available on GitHub under the Apache 2.0 license.
Ofc they're all still in the Git history: https://github.com/bitnami/containers/commit/7651d48119a1f3f... but they must have a very interesting interpretation of what available means then.
